As for the cardboard bezel, there are 3 variants, 1. black, 2. Spickels of paint and 3. Fireworks.

I think the Starsplash has black, and you can easy create that from black cardboard.

Found some time to measure the cardboard bezel..




Lets tape it to the table and try to straighten it as flat as possible.




Height: 91,5 cm.




width: 59,9 cm.




Center width monitor hole: 30 cm.




Center Height monitor hole: 39,4 cm.




Distance monitor hole from bottom: 3 cm.



And at last a vector PDF on scale..

Zaccaria-Cardboard-Bezel-Vertical.pdf

The monitor hole is a bit curved, and the difference between the center and the top / bottom opening untill the rounded corner is 1 cm.

The radius of the corners is 3 cm.

I hope this helps you to reproduce a cardboard bezel.  ;)
